Hey y’all I have a few quick questions about shedding. 1) Autumn is almost a year old now (this month is her birthday month!?)....So my question is how often should she be shedding? 2) Autumn also has a really weird way of shedding. Instead of shedding along her full body every time, she just sheds parts of it. (i.e. legs one week, tail the next, then her head, then her body). She has always done this. Is she okay? Is this normal? 3) How long should she be at a year now? I know, a lot of questions, but I just thought I’d ask.
That all sounds just fine. Her shedding will be less frequent since she isn't growing as quickly but the actual amount will vary and I can't say for sure how often it will be. Shedding in pieces (even a scale at a time sometimes) is how it will look from now on. It's more rare to see a full body shed in an adult. Again it's hard to say for sure about her length since they grow at different rates. Generally an adult is around 16-24'' long and anywhere from maybe 400-800g (ish).
